About This Item

London: A. Zwemmer Ltd, 1970. Book. Very Good. Pictorial Softcover. First Edition. 205mm Tall, 8vo. An illustrated guide to over 200 key figures in the Gangster Film and Crime in the Cinema. Index. A little wear to cover edges..
